Whether you're looking to modernize with sleek finishes or craft a cozy, character-filled haven, this studio is <strong>for a visionary with a keen eye for design</strong>.</p> <p>Bring your imagination and make <strong>Unit 2OS</strong> your own!</p> <p>Nestled in the serene and picturesque <strong>Tudor City Historic District</strong>, <strong>2 Tudor City Place</strong> is a full-service post-war cooperative offering a peaceful retreat in the heart of Midtown Manhattan. Conveniently located by <strong>Grand Central Station</strong> and the <strong>Midtown Tunnel</strong>, yet set apart from the city's hustle, this residence enjoys the best of both worlds-urban accessibility and tranquil surroundings.</p> <p>Built in <strong>1954</strong> and converted to a cooperative in <strong>1981</strong>, the building comprises <strong>333 residences across 15 floors</strong>, separated by a beautifully landscaped <strong>private courtyard</strong>. Residents enjoy a range of amenities, including a <strong>bike room, storage</strong>, and access to the <strong>fitness center</strong> at <strong>5 Tudor City Place</strong> (available for extra cost). The co-op welcomes <strong>pied- -terres, co-purchasing, and parental purchases for kids</strong>, offering flexibility to suit various lifestyles. Notably, the <strong>monthly maintenance includes electricity</strong>, adding to the convenience of ownership.</p> <p>With its <strong>classic red brick fa ade</strong>, the building is perfectly positioned adjacent to the lush <strong>Tudor City Greens Parks</strong>, a hidden gem of greenery and tranquility, recognized on the <strong>National Register of Historic Places</strong> since <strong>1986</strong>.</p> <p>For those seeking a harmonious blend of <strong>historic charm, modern convenience, and a peaceful ambiance</strong>, <strong>2 Tudor City Place</strong> presents an exceptional opportunity to call home.</p> <p>There is a 90.63 assessment until January 2027</p>
